About me

Hello there. I am a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ist located in California. I have experience working with youth and adults from a variety of backgrounds. I provide individual therapy using strategies that are tailored to fit you. In sessions I often use elements of CBT and Attachment Theory. I also draw from Solution Focused Therapy, and am mindful of using trauma informed care. I show up with empathy, humor, and patience, and I value working collaboratively alongside my clients. I believe that you are the expert on your life and my role is to provide support and guidance along the way. I often help people struggling with depression and anxiety, family and relationship challenges, career and school stress, and self-esteem. I'm glad you're here and I look forward to meeting you!

In our first session together, here's what you can expect

In our first session, I will start by introducing myself, and briefly share some information on policies and procedures. After that, you can expect to share a bit about yourself, including what brings you into therapy and what your goals are. This is more of a get to know you session, and you get to set the pace and share what is comfortable for you.

My treatment methods

Cognitive Behavioral (CBT)

I have 8 years of experience using CBT techniques to help clients reduce symptoms of depression and anxiety, improve self esteem, and cultivate healthier relationships. I aim to support client's in understanding the connection between their thoughts, feelings, and behaviors, and learning tools to challenge and reframe distressing thoughts that are contributing to distress.

Attachment-based

I use Attachment Based therapy to explore experiences of early childhood, particularly relationships with adult caregivers, that may be contributing to difficulties in adulthood. Attachment wounds can lead to unhelpful patterns of thinking and behavior, low self-esteem, and difficulty forming healthy personal relationships with others.

Acceptance and commitment (ACT)

I use ACT concepts to help client's notice their thoughts and emotions and accept them without judgment in order to reduce distress and increase self-compassion. I also support clients in identifying what they value in life and finding ways to pursue more of those things to create greater life satisfaction.
